
body
{
	background-color: #47352C;
	margin-top: 0px;
	margin-left: 0px;
}

div, p
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#5F5C57;
}

div#wrapper
{
	width:725px;
	height:500px;
	margin:40px auto auto auto;
}

/* top */
.topPart { height:41px; }

div#containerTop { width:725px; }

div#gaucheHaut
{
	float: left;
	width: 18px;
	background-image:url(../images/haut-Cg.gif);
	background-repeat:no-repeat;
}

div#droitHaut
{
	float: right;
	width: 16px;
	background-image:url(../images/haut-Cd.gif);
	background-repeat:no-repeat;
}

div#millieuHaut
{
	vertical-align:top;
	text-align:right;
	float: left;
	width: 691px;
	background-image:url(../images/haut-bg.gif);
	background-position:bottom;
	background-repeat:repeat-x;
}

.menuHeure
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:9px;
	color:#c3b7b1;
	margin-right:8px;
	margin-top:66px;
}

a.menu:link
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	text-decoration: none;
	color:#908580;
}

a.menu:visited
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	text-decoration: none;
	color:#908580;
}

a.menu:hover
{
	font-size:10px;
	color:#FFFFFF;
	text-decoration: none;
}

a.menu:active
{
	font-size:10px;
	text-decoration: none;
}

.menuSlash { color:#908580; }

/* millieu */
.milleuPart { height:440px; }

div#containerMillieu
{
	width:725px;
	margin:0;
}

div#gauche
{
	float: left;
	width: 28px;
	background-image:url(../images/cote-g.gif);
	background-repeat:repeat-y;
}

div#millieu
{
	float: left;
	width: 671px;
}

div#droit
{
	float: right;
	width: 26px;
	background-image:url(../images/cote-d.gif);
	background-repeat:repeat-y;
}

/* Footer */
.footpart { height:30px; }

div#footer { width:725px; }

div#gaucheFoot
{
	float: left;
	width: 18px;
	background-image:url(../images/bas-Cg.gif);
	background-repeat:no-repeat;
}

div#droitFoot
{
	float: right;
	width: 16px;
	background-image:url(../images/bas-Cd.gif);
	background-repeat:no-repeat;
}

div#millieuFoot
{
	float: left;
	width: 691px;
	background-image:url(../images/bas-bg.gif);
	background-repeat:repeat-x;
}

div#copyWrite
{
	float: left;
	width: 300px;
}

div#pd
{
	float: right;
	width: 300px;
}

.copyWritePart
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	padding-top:14px;
	color:#908580;
}

.pdPart
{
	padding-top:18px;
	text-align:right;
}

/* contenue banière */
div#contenueTop { width: 671px; }

.contenuePart { height:300px; }

/* contenue bas */
div#contenue
{
	width:671px;
	margin:0;
}

div#gaucheContenue
{
	text-align:right;
	float: left;
	width: 131px;
	background-color:#694A3B;
	background-image:url(../images/bg-menu.gif);
	background-repeat:no-repeat;
}

div#droitContenue
{
	float: right;
	width: 530px;
}

div#droitContenueBgris
{
	float: right;
	width: 530px;
	background-image:url(../images/bg-gris.gif);
	background-repeat:no-repeat;
}

div#millieuContenue
{
	float: left;
	width: 10px;
	background-color:#FFFFFF;
}

div#contentColGauche
{
	width: 267px;
	height: 299px;
	float:left;
}

div#contentColGaucheEve
{
	width: 227px;
	height: 299px;
	float:left;
}

div#contentColDroitEve
{
	width: 227px;
	height: 299px;
	float:left;
}

div#contentColDroit
{
	width: 262px;
	height: 299px;
	float:right;
}

a.contact:link
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-decoration: none;
	color:#5F5C57;
}

a.contact:visited
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	text-decoration: none;
	color:#5F5C57;
}

a.contact:hover
{
	font-size:11px;
	color:#FFFFFF;
	text-decoration: none;
}

a.contact:active
{
	font-size:11px;
	color:#5F5C57;
}
